LearningNotes

  • 2022-08-11
  • 浏览 (2883)

Vue如何使用G2绘制图片

Docker Compose入门学习

DockerDesktop入门简介

Docker图形化工具Portainer介绍与安装

1.Docker

Docker操作系统之Alpine

如何将镜像推送到阿里云容器镜像服务

对象存储MinIO入门介绍

ElasticSearch安装与介绍

Beats入门简介

Kibana入门

Logstash入门简介

ElasticStack综合案例

Gin内容介绍

http及Template介绍

GORM介绍和使用

GORM CRUD指南

Go Web开发教程

Windows下Go语言的安装

Go中的日期函数

Go中的指针

Go中的结构体

Go中的包

Go中的接口

Golang goroutine channel 实现并发和并行

Go中的反射

Go中的文件和目录操作

Go语言发展简史

Go语言中的变量和常量

Golang的数据类型

Go的运算符

Go的流程控制

Go的数组

Go的切片

Golang map详解

Go的函数

Decimal v1.2.0

decimal

Getting Started

GJSON Path Syntax

Match

Pretty

Flag包的用法

Go操作MySQL数据库

sqlx的使用

Go操作Redis

Go操作消息队列

Go的依赖管理Go Module

Go Context的使用

日志收集项目架构设计及Kafka介绍

etcd介绍

ES介绍和使用

Kafka消费示例

Kibana介绍和使用

Prometheus和Grafana介绍

Go并发编程

互联网协议

HTTP请求

日志库

反射

单元测试

Golang基础

go-zero架构设计

go-zero简介

go-zero适用场景

使用goctl快速创建项目

使用go-zero构建微服务项目

基本原理

Gin框架中让tmpl模板文件有语法提示

Goland添加注释模板

执行GoGet命令下载依赖失败的解决方法

对象实例化内存布局与访问定位

直接内存 Direct Memory

执行引擎

StringTable

垃圾回收概述

垃圾回收相关算法

垃圾回收相关概念

垃圾回收器

JVM与Java体系结构

类加载子系统

运行时数据区概述及线程

程序计数器

虚拟机栈

本地方法接口

本地方法栈

方法区

没有意识到线程重用导致用户信息错乱的Bug

加锁前要清楚锁和被保护的对象是不是一个层面的

线程池的声明需要手动进行

连接池:别让连接池帮了倒忙

配置连接超时和读取超时参数的学问

小心 Spring 的事务可能没有生效

InnoDB 是如何存储数据的?

注意 equals 和 == 的区别

“危险”的 Double

浅谈ArrayList及扩容机制

JVM类加载机制

Java中的双亲委派机制以及如何打破

Java注解和反射

VisualVM安装VisualGC插件

Java使用Ip2region替代淘宝IP接口

前后端分离项目解决跨域问题

谈谈你对AQS的理解

谈谈你对ThreadLocal的理解

Kubernetes核心技术Service

Kubernetes控制器Controller详解

Kubernetes配置管理

Kubernetes集群安全机制

Kubernetes核心技术Ingress

Kubernetes核心技术Helm

Kubernetes持久化存储

Kubernetes集群资源监控

Kubernetes搭建高可用集群

Kubernetes容器交付介绍

Kubernetes简介

搭建K8S集群

使用kubeadm-ha脚本一键安装K8S

Kubernetes可视化界面kubesphere

Kubernetes配置默认存储类

使用kubeadm方式搭建K8S集群

使用二进制方式搭建K8S集群

使用Rancher2.0搭建Kubernetes集群

Kubernetes中的CRI

Kubeadm和二进制方式对比

Kubernetes集群管理工具kubectl

Kubernetes集群YAML文件详解

Kubernetes核心技术Pod

Kubernetes核心技术-Controller

云平台核心

Docker基本概念

Kubernetes基础概念

云原生实战

从底层了解IO多路复用模型

Redis中的数据结构

Redis中的跳跃表

Redis实现分布式锁

Redis缓存穿透-布隆过滤器

通俗理解多种IO模型

Bean的生命周期

Eureka管理页面配置/actuator/info接口返回git信息

SpringBoot中使用注解的方式创建队列和交换机

SpringBoot拦截器无法注入Bean

SpringBoot解决时区问题

Spring Security造成Eureka 无法使用iframe的内嵌页面的解决方法

Swagger-ui.html页面出现404

使用DevTools实现SpringBoot项目热部署

前言

SpringBoot项目将Swagger升级3.0

API网关

Feign配置全局Sentinel流控异常和降级异常

Nacos关闭心跳日志

消息总线SpringCloudBUS

SpringCloud Stream 消息驱动

SpringCloudSleuth分布式请求链路跟踪

Nacos

SpringCloudAlibabaSentinel实现熔断和限流

SpringCloudAlibabaSeata处理分布式事务

微服务

搭建一个SpringCloud

Eureka集群

Eureka停更后的替换

Ribbon实现负载均衡

OpenFeign实现服务调用

Hystrix断路器

服务网关

分布式配置中心SpringCloudConfig

前言

配置Sentinel规则持久化到Nacos中

使用Axios拦截器携带token以及跳转错误页面

ElementUI中Upload组件如何批量上传

SPA 的 SEO 方案对比、最终实践

VueX学习

my-project

Vue中Html和Markdown互相转换

Vue中input框自动聚焦

Vue中使用Vue-cropper进行图片裁剪

myproject

Vue中对数组变化监听

Vue中防止XSS脚本攻击

使用SpringBoot+Vue+Echarts制作一个文章贡献度表

Vue使用vue-count-to插件对数字显示美化

Vue内容页面SEO优化方案

Vue如何制作一个评论模块

README

Vue对Element中的el-tag添加@click事件无效

前言

Vue项目中引入markdown编辑器vditor

Vue项目使用阿里巴巴矢量图标库

README

Vue项目如何关闭Eslint校验

Vue项目引入CDN加速

Vue项目引入侧边导航栏

Vue项目打包后动态配置解决方案

SPA 的 SEO 方案对比、最终实践

前言

vue打包后的dist文件如何启动测试

前言

解决Vue项目打包后js文件过大的问题

进程通信和线程通信

死锁的产生与解决

操作系统

MyBatis 缓存机制

MySQL索引

栈的压入弹出序列

从尾到头打印链表

链表中倒数第K个节点

反转链表

合并两个排序的链表

复杂链表的复制

两个链表的公共结点

孩子们的游戏(圆圈中最后剩下的数)

链表中环的入口结点

二进制中的1的个数

斐波那契数列

不用加减乘除做加法

数组中出现次数超过一半的数字

整数中1出现的个数

数组中只出现一次的数字

树的遍历

重建二叉树

树的子结构

二叉树的镜像

从上往下打印二叉树

二叉搜索树的后序遍历序列

青蛙跳台阶

二叉树中和为某一值的路径

二叉搜索树与双向链表

最小的K个数

数据流中的中位数

二叉树的下一个节点

对称的二叉树

按之字形顺序打印二叉树

把二叉树打印成多行

二叉搜索树的第K个节点

序列化二叉树

找出丑数

连续子数组的最大和

矩形覆盖

排序算法-冒泡插入选择

希尔排序

归并排序

快速排序

二维数组中的查找

替换空格

两个栈实现一个队列

旋转数组的最小数字

调整数组顺序使奇数位于偶数前面

包含min函数的栈

KMP算法

1. 两个栈实现一个队列:[^本题考点 队列 栈]

25.重建二叉树

补码

动态规划问题

动态规划

动态规划问题

贪心算法

CatBoost的安装和使用

Embedding层的作用

Stacking算法介绍

使用SMOTE算法进行过采样

决策树和分类树

集成学习简介

主要内容

Stacking

模型融合方法

机器学习算法之Boosting算法

模型融合

线程池(Java中有哪些方法获取多线程)

死锁编码及定位分析

JVM体系结构

JVM面试汇总

JVM参数调优

Java中的引用

Java内存溢出OOM

垃圾收集器

Linux诊断原因

Github学习

乐观锁和悲观锁

谈谈对Volatile的理解

Volatile不保证原子性

Volatile禁止指令重排

Volatile的应用

CAS底层原理

原子类AtomicInteger的ABA问题

Collection线程不安全的举例

值传递和引用传递

Java锁之公平锁和非公平锁

可重入锁和递归锁ReentrantLock

Java锁之自旋锁

独占锁(写锁) / 共享锁(读锁) / 互斥锁

为什么Synchronized无法禁止指令重排,却能保证有序性

CountDownLatch

CyclicBarrier

Semaphore:信号量

阻塞队列

Synchronized和Lock的区别

Java8新特性

Lambda表达式

方法引用与构造器引用

Stream API

并行流与顺序流

Optional类

Java中的专业词汇

Java NIO

NIO深入

Spring源码

等等与equals的区别

代码块

分布式锁

Mysql默认搜索引擎

Java两种动态代理JDK动态代理和CGLIB动态代理

集群高并发情况下如何保证分布式唯一全局Id生成

README

字节跳动面试总结

京东零售 提前批 Java一面

京东零售 提前批 Java 二面

滴滴SP提前批Java123面

如何设计一个高并发系统

数据库分库分表的面试连环炮

MySQL读写分离及主从时延

如何设计高可用系统架构-系统熔断、降级、限流

消息队列的面试连环炮

分布式搜索引擎的面试连环炮

分布式缓存

Redis的面试连环炮

Redis集群模式

分布式系统的面试连环炮

分布式系统幂等性与顺序性及分布式锁

分布式Session方案

Spring中的事务

分布式事务解决方案

PDF下载

三次握手和四次挥手

http和https

TCP中的流量控制和拥塞控制

计算机网络分层结构 - 物理层

数据链路层

HTTP中的状态码

0  赞